Knowledge Base
AI-generated store context used for blog content creation.
The Knowledge Base is your brand profile — a structured document that the AI reads every time it generates a blog post. It contains everything the AI needs to write content that matches your brand: identity, products, audience, tone, and messaging.
When you first set up the app, the AI automatically analyzes your store and creates this profile. You can expand, review, and edit it anytime.
Store knowledge base content
Click the Store knowledge base content accordion to expand and view your brand profile. The content is organized into 7 default sections:
Brand Identity
Brand name, industry, unique value proposition, mission, vision, taglines
Product Overview
Main collections, key features, design aesthetic, product examples
Target Audience
Customer segments, demographics, psychographics, purchase motivations
Tone & Voice
Tone adjectives, formality, humor, point of view, sentence style
Messaging Pillars
3–5 key messages that define your brand communication
Brand Vocabulary
Preferred words, words to avoid, signature phrases
Content Guidelines
Content goals, CTA style, formatting preferences, do/don't lists
How to edit
Expand the Store knowledge base content accordion.
Click into the editor and make your changes. The editor supports headings, bold, italic, bullet lists, numbered lists, and links.
You can:
Edit any field in the 7 default sections.
Add new sections — for example, "Competitor Positioning", "Content Topics to Avoid", or "Preferred Keywords".
Remove sections you don't need.
Rearrange sections to match your priorities.
Click Save when you're done.
The AI uses your updated profile for all future blog generation — no need to re-enter information each time.
Tip: Focus on the Tone & Voice and Brand Vocabulary sections first. These have the biggest impact on how your generated content sounds.
First-time setup
If the AI hasn't analyzed your store yet (new install or skipped onboarding), you'll see an empty state with two options:
Analyze my store — The AI crawls your store and generates a profile automatically. Free and takes about 30 seconds.
Write manually — Open a blank editor and write your brand profile from scratch.
How the AI uses your Knowledge Base
When you generate a blog post (using AI Writer, AI Assistant, AI Inline, or any AI feature), the AI automatically uses your Knowledge Base as context. You don't need to do anything extra — it just works.
This means:
Blog posts match your brand tone and voice
Product references are accurate to your catalog
Messaging stays consistent across all generated content

Content protection
Reduce unauthorized copying and scraping of your blog content.
Disable keyboard shortcuts
Blocks Copy (⌘C), Cut (⌘X), Save (⌘S), and View source (⌘⌥U) on your blog pages
Disable right click
Prevents the right-click context menu on your blog pages
Toggle Content protection on, then check the options you want. Click Save to apply.
Note: Content protection discourages casual copying but is not 100% secure. Visitors can still access page source through browser developer tools. It works best as a deterrent for the majority of readers.

Structured data
Manage structured content settings for posts.
Article structured data
Add structured data to help search engines better understand and display your blog post. When enabled, the app automatically injects Article schema markup into your posts when they are published.
The preview card shows how your blog post appears in search results with structured data - including your site name, URL, post title, and meta description.
Toggle Article structured data on and click Save to enable it for all blog posts.
Tip: Keep Article structured data enabled. It helps Google identify your content as blog articles and can improve how your posts appear in search results.
